IN FOCUS – WD2019: Nearly 40% of the world’s girls and women live in countries failing on gender equality, SDG Index finds

Read Report Here   Vancouver, (Canada):Results for 129 countries measured by a new Sustainable Development Goals (SDG) Gender Index released today by Equal Measures 2030 show that the world is far from achieving gender equality, with 1.4 billion girls and women living in countries that get a “very poor” failing grade on gender equality. Deliver to Empower

In 2007, a groundbreaking organization, Women Deliver, was founded that advocated for gender equality and health and rights of women and girls all over the world. AWIMA-UAE strengthens women’s empowerment in the Arab region

May 29th, 2019, Dubai (UAE): The Arab Women in Maritime Association (AWIMA) recently arranged its first gathering in the UAE with female representatives from both government and private sectors. The event was strategically supported by Women in International Shipping Association WISTA-ARABIA UAE. Award winning creative leader to head Leo Burnett Worldwide

May 23rd, 2019,Dubai (UAE): Award-winning creative leader Liz Taylor will join Leo Burnett Worldwide as chief creative officer. Starting July 8, she will sit at the agency’s Chicago headquarters leading the creative direction of the global agency network. Sharjah Women’s Sports Club Team Crowned Basketball Champions

May 15th, 2019, Sharjah (UAE): The Sharjah Women’s Sports Club Team was crowned the basketball champions at the 11th Ramadan Women’s Sports Tournament (RWST) after a glorious final score of 66-25 against Brunei Airline.
